How to ask for it in a taxi
- Show the driver: 名古屋市美術館
- Then point and say: ここまでお願いします (koko made onegai shimasu) — "please take me here".
- If asked which area: 栄二丁目, 愛知県.
- On arrival: 領収書をください (ryōshūsho o kudasai) — "please give me a receipt".
Museums are frequently inside a larger park or cultural complex that shares its name with several other buildings. The kanji plus the ward name is what tells a driver which entrance to pull up at.

Frequently asked questions
How do you read 名古屋市美術館?
名古屋市美術館 is read なごやしびじゅつかん, romanised Nagoyashi Bijutsukan. English-language sources usually write it Nagoya City Art Museum. The kanji is what a taxi driver reads; the reading is only there so you know what you are handing over.
How do I show Nagoya City Art Museum to a taxi driver in Japan?
Do not try to pronounce it. Show the driver the Japanese characters 名古屋市美術館 together with the sentence ここまでお願いします ("please take me here"). Use the button on this page to build a card with both, then save it to your phone or print it — it works with no mobile signal.
Do I also need the address for Nagoya City Art Museum?
For a well-known museum the name is usually enough, but adding 住所 (the address) removes all doubt, especially where several places share a name. This museum is in Sakae 2-chōme, Aichi Prefecture; open the map link on this page to copy the exact address before you travel.
